Former Patriot Coach Loses Obesity Surgery Malpractice Lawsuit

East News • July 26, 2007
A Boston jury has found against Notre Dame football coach Charlie Weis in his medical malpractice lawsuit against two doctors he claimed botched his care after he had gastric bypass surgery five ...
